How RFID Technology Works in Asset Tracking

An RFID system includes tags, readers, and software that work together to collect and manage data. Each tag contains a microchip and an antenna, allowing it to send information when it receives a signal from a reader. Some readers can scan up to 600 items at once, which reduces the time needed for inventory checks. This saves effort. The system then processes this data and displays it in a useful format.

Passive tags are commonly used because they are affordable and do not require a battery, while active tags can transmit signals over longer distances, sometimes reaching 130 meters in open environments where interference is low. These differences are important. Businesses choose based on their needs and budget.

RFID systems do not require line-of-sight scanning, which means items can be detected even when they are placed inside containers or stacked together, making it easier to track large inventories in busy environments where speed and accuracy are critical. Workers notice improvements. Daily operations become smoother.

Benefits of RFID for Business Asset Control

Companies using RFID systems often experience better tracking accuracy and fewer lost items within the first few months. When tracking is automated, employees spend less time searching for items and more time focusing on their tasks. This improves efficiency.

RFID systems also enhance security by sending alerts when assets move outside defined areas, which is useful for facilities managing over 1,500 items across multiple locations. Quick alerts help. This reduces the risk of theft and ensures important equipment remains available.

Another benefit is better data analysis, as RFID systems provide real-time information about asset movement and usage, allowing managers to make informed decisions about resource allocation and purchasing over time. This supports cost control. It also reduces waste and improves planning.

Industries Using RFID for Asset Tracking

RFID technology is used across many industries where tracking is essential. Retail businesses use it to manage stock levels and prevent shortages during busy seasons. Warehouses handle thousands of items daily. Logistics companies rely on RFID to monitor shipments across different stages.

Healthcare facilities use RFID to track equipment such as beds, wheelchairs, and medical devices, ensuring they are always available when needed. Manufacturing plants use RFID to monitor production processes and track materials from start to finish. It prevents delays. Construction companies also use RFID to manage tools across multiple sites.

Here are some common uses of RFID systems:

– Tracking inventory in warehouses
– Monitoring medical equipment in hospitals
– Managing shipments in logistics operations
– Keeping track of tools on construction sites

Educational institutions use RFID for attendance systems and library tracking, showing how adaptable this technology is across different environments. It keeps records clear. Many sectors now depend on it.

Challenges and Planning Considerations

RFID systems offer many advantages, yet there are challenges businesses must consider before implementation. The initial setup cost can be high, especially for large facilities that require many readers, tags, and software systems to track thousands of assets effectively. This requires planning. Smaller companies may need to budget carefully.

Signal interference can affect system performance in areas with metal surfaces or liquids, which may block or reflect radio waves and reduce accuracy, so proper testing and adjustments are needed to ensure reliable results across different environments and working conditions. These factors matter. Setup must be handled carefully.

Employee training is also important, as workers must understand how to use the system and interpret data correctly to avoid errors and ensure that the system provides accurate and useful information for daily operations across departments. Training takes time. With proper support, these challenges can be managed.
